1:1 Primary Teaching Assistant Are you passionate about working with children and would like to make a difference to a child's school experience? Are you a caring, patient and positive individual? If you answered YES to the above, this may be the role for you. We are looking for a Teaching Assistant seeking a 1:1 role with a child in a school in the Tunbridge Wells/Pembury area. It will be your job to support the student in and out of the classroom. Your main duties will be: Supporting the student with everyday tasks in and out of the classroom i.e. school work and break times. Being a friendly face for the student to trust and feel safe with. Help them to achieve the work set by the Teacher at a pace that works for them. Be a helping hand to the Teacher. Create a secure and trusting relationship with the student to promote their learning. To help and motivate the student and clarify clear instruction within the classroom and set boundaries. This is a great role for someone looking to make a difference and find a rewarding job role. Children need extra support sometimes and it will be your job to do just that, whilst creating a positive environment for them to learn. You will be planning, preparing and delivering assigned work and learning activities to an individual pupil, whilst assessing and recording their development and progress. There are no qualifications needed for this role, however phonics experience is desirable but not essential.
